@verikami/remark-deflist-revisited

GH CC CI NPM JSR

Remark plugin. A wrapper around remark-deflist with improved support for nested definition lists. It preserves all the original functionality and performs additional processing. Bun, Deno and Cloudflare Workers compatibility. Also works in Astro and web browser.

Usage

The problem with remark-deflist is that the plugin renders nested list items inside <dd> incorrectly.

Markdown

Term
: - item A
  - item B
  - item C

With remark-deflist

<dl>
<dt> Term </dt>
<dd>
  <ul>
    <li> item A </li>
  </ul>
</dl>
<ul>
  <li> item B </li>
  <li> item C </li>
</ul>

With @verikami/remark-deflist-revisited

<dl>
<dt>Term</dt>
<dd>
  <ul>
    <li> item A </li>
    <li> item B </li>
    <li> item C </li>
  </ul>
</dl>

Usage in Node.js

import { remark } from "remark";
import html from "remark-html";
import deflist from "@verikami/remark-deflist-revisited";

const markdown = `
Term
: - item A
  - item B
  - item C
`;

const output = await remark()
  .use(deflist)
  .use(html)
  .process(markdown);

console.log(String(output));

Usage in Deno

import { remark } from "npm:remark@^15";
import html from "npm:remark-html@^16";
import deflist from "npm:@verikami/remark-deflist-revisited";

// (...) same code as above

Usage in Astro

import { defineConfig } from "astro/config";
import remarkDeflist from "@verikami/remark-deflist-revisited";

export default defineConfig({
  markdown: {
    remarkPlugins: [
      remarkDeflist
    ]
  }
});
